Transaction

4c044f6e9eceba10037c672c8e08e544b8aaf1b258c2e487b11f2c8907576364
425,974 confirmations
Timestamp
1521850007
Block514,870
Fee11,500 sats
Fee rate25 sats/vB
view on mempool.space

Inputs & Outputs